Compare Newington to Trumbull
This post compares Newington, Connecticut to Trumbull, Connecticut across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Newington (CDP) | Trumbull (CDP) |
---|---|---|
Population | 30,603 | 36,455 |
Income (median) | $60,656 | $80,783 |
Home Value (median) | $229,900 | $394,600 |
White | 81% | 85% |
Black | 5% | 4% |
Asian | 5% | 6% |
With Kids | 26% | 37% |
Age (median) | 44 | 43 |
Rentals | 21% | 12% |
